Transaction 59e05b80673838294f457803b456eae2c6d521948cf1a05eb043ced720b11149
1 Input
1 Output
-
59e05b80673838294f457803b456eae2c6d521948cf1a05eb043ced720b11149:0
- value
- 581267
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b96dfbe9ab21b63d267d14a1f5f340bb68a84ee OP_EQUAL
- address
- 3A3J9uiiQJXtjsijxBED1y5W1oLaqYWtA3